A birthday cake and a buffalo are quite different from each other. Let's break down their characteristics to understand the contrasts:

Birthday Cake:
1. Composition: A birthday cake is a baked dessert made from a mixture of ingredients such as flour, butter, sugar, eggs, and flavorings. It is usually soft and sweet.
2. Purpose: It is traditionally prepared and enjoyed on someone's birthday to celebrate their special day.
3. Appearance: Birthday cakes often have a layered structure with frosting on the outside. They can be decorated with candles, edible decorations, and personalized messages.

Buffalo:
1. Animal Species: Buffalo refers to a large mammal species, specifically the American bison or the water buffalo, depending on the context. They belong to the Bovidae family.
2. Physical Characteristics: Buffaloes have a massive build, with a heavy body, large head, and distinct horns. Their fur is usually shaggy and thick, and their color varies depending on the species.
3. Habitat: Buffaloes are found in different regions around the world and usually reside in grasslands or wooded areas.
4. Ecological Role: As large herbivores, buffaloes play a significant role in shaping and maintaining their ecosystems by grazing grass, dispersing seeds, and creating wallows.

To summarize, a birthday cake is a delicious dessert typically associated with celebrating birthdays, while a buffalo is a large mammal that serves important ecological roles in various habitats.
